Disassembly And Assembly: Assembly

  1. Install the oil cooler (A/T model only).
    Fig 1: Identifying Oil Cooler & Components

    Pay attention to direction of conical washer. 

  2. Clean the contact portion of the tank.
    Fig 2: Cleaning Contact Portion Of Tank

  3. Install sealing rubber.
    Fig 3: Installing Sealing Rubber

    Push it in with fingers. 

    Be careful not to twist sealing rubber. 

  4. Caulk tank in specified sequence with Tool.
    Fig 4: Caulking Tank In Specified Sequence With Tool

    Fig 5: Keeping Tool Perpendicular To Radiator

    • Use pliers in the locations where Tool cannot be used.
      Fig 6: Using Pliers Where Tool Cannot Be Used.

  5. Make sure that the rim is completely crimped down.
    Fig 7: Making Sure That Rim Is Completely Crimped Down

    1. Standard height H: 8.0 - 8.4 mm (0.315 - 0.331 in) 
  6. Confirm that there is no leakage.

    Refer to  INSPECTION  .
